Sort the pull items by call number
Watch for items not in "mstax" and sort accordingly, e.g. ref, oversized, media circulating, etc.
The pull cart has a list of which call numbers are on which floor
AFN requests generally print already in order and may require little extra sorting
For each request (piece of paperwork)
Find the item in stacks using highlighted call number and handwritten notes
Be sure to pull the correct volume of a volume set; only pull the exact edition
Check that the paperwork title and item title match
Place paperwork in item
For loans, fold paper lengthwise and put in book
For scans, keep paperwork flat and place in book
Locate the article that the request is for and place the paperwork at the start of that article. If you can't find the article, pull the item anyways and bring it to a staff person.
If you cannot initially find an item, put the paperwork aside and finish the pull for that floor. Then search these areas (in descending order):
Overstock Room and/or any re-shelving carts nearby
Carts by the Check-In/ILL Borrowing Return Area
If you are still unable to locate the item(s) give the paperwork to an ILL staffer.
Pulling Media items from the DSC (Digital Scholarship Commons)
The only items that go out through Interlibrary Loan are DVDs, VHS, and occasionally the affiliated guides
Identify yourself to a Media Desk student, "I work at Interlibrary Loan, and I’m here to pull media items for these ILL requests."
Once the student has given the okay, go behind the Media Desk in the DSC to pull the items from the shelves
Ask the student at the desk if you have trouble finding an item
DVD
Find and pull the DVD from it's respective place on the shelf. If you have any questions the DSC desk staff are a valuable resource.
VHS
Pull the VHS tape out of its original case and put the case back on the shelf with the call number facing inward, not showing. Place the tape in a loaner plastic case, which are found behind the DSC Circ Desk.
Guide *Less Common Request*
Find the requested guide on the affiliated guide shelf — VHS, DVD, or in the case of some DVDs, on the DVD shelf alongside the DVD.
